Period: Nov. 2012 – Oct. 2015

Project type: FP7-ICT Large-scale integrating project (IP)

Funding: ICT Programme (European Commission)

URL: http://www.mobile-cloud-networking.eu/

Objective: MobileCloud addresses a mobile network with decentralized computing and smart storage, offered as one service (on-demand, elastic and pay-as-you-go). The top-level objectives of the MobileCloud project are two-fold. On the one side, to develop a novel mobile “network” architecture and technologies, using proof-of-concept prototypes, to lead the way from current mobile networks to a fully cloud-based mobile communication system. On the other side, to extend cloud computing to support on-demand and elastic provisioning of novel mobile services.

GROW Contribution: Besides contributing to general aspects, e.g., scenarios and architectures, there are focused contributions on radio network areas (management of virtual radio resources and load-balancing between radio-bearers and BBU-pools).
